KS64 DZR is a 2014 BMW 640 in Black with a 2,993c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2014 BMW 640 models, the average MOT pass rate is 83.9% with a typical mileage of 56,359 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 640 fails its MOT is tyre has ply or cords exposed, accounting for 691 recorded failures. If you're considering buying KS64 DZR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 640 typically stays on UK roads for around 15 years. At 12 years old, this BMW 640 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
